SpaltvsTriplePearl

Spalt (aroma) and TriplePearl (dual purpose) serve different purposes. Comparing acids, aromas and character helps pick the right hop.

Key differences

When to pick Spalt

  • Aroma-focused - ideal for dry hopping

When to pick TriplePearl

  • Higher alpha acid - stronger bittering
  • More essential oils - more intense aroma
  • More myrcene - pronounced citrus and resinous notes
  • Versatile - works for both bittering and aroma
  • Richer, more complex aroma profile

Property

PropertySpaltTriplePearl
Alpha acid2.5–5.7%10–11.2%
Beta acid3–5%3.3–4.2%
Co-humulone22–29%21–55%
Total oil0.5–0.9 mL0.8–1.8 mL
Myrcene20–35%39–55%
Humulene20–30%7–11%
Caryophyllene8–13%3–5%
Farnesene12–18%0–1%
OriginGermanyUnited States
PurposeAromaDual purpose
